引言

在数字经济快速发展的今天,人们对区块链技术的关注度日益增加。作为一种去中心化的分布式账本技术,区块链不仅改变了传统金融体系的运作方式,同时也为企业的透明度、安全性和效率带来了全新的机遇。本文将深入探讨区块链平台技术的开发,探讨其潜在的应用场景、技术挑战以及未来的发展方向。

区块链技术的基本概念

区块链是一种以加密技术为基础的分布式账本,通过多个节点的共识机制实现数据的共享与验证。在区块链的每一个“区块”中,都记录着一系列交易数据,并通过加密技术与前一个区块相连,从而形成一条不可篡改的数据链条。区块链技术的核心特点包括去中心化、透明性和可追溯性,使得其在各种领域中具有广泛的应用潜力。

区块链平台开发的必要性

随着区块链技术的不断发展,各类区块链平台如雨后春笋般涌现,开发这些平台的必要性变得愈发明显。首先,区块链技术的应用可以显著提高数据传输的效率和安全性。在金融、物流、医疗等多个行业里,区块链技术可以实现信息的实时共享与处理,从而降低交易成本。其次,区块链提供了一种新的商业模式,通过智能合约的应用,可以实现自动化的交易及结算,减少人为干预,降低潜在的合规风险。此外,区块链的透明性能够提升用户对平台的信任,进而推动用户的活跃度和忠诚度。开发出优质的区块链平台,可以为企业创造更为丰富的商业价值。

区块链平台的关键技术

在开发区块链平台时,有几项关键技术需要重点考虑。首先是共识机制,确保网络中各个节点能够就交易的合法性达成一致,常见的共识机制包括工作量证明(PoW)、权益证明(PoS)和代理权益证明(DPoS)等。其次是智能合约的语言与执行环境,智能合约是区块链平台独特的功能之一,其代码必须编写得当,以确保合约的执行结果能够如预期般准确。此外,数据存储与隐私保护亦是区块链开发中不容忽视的问题,如何在保持数据可追溯性的同时保障用户的隐私将是未来技术发展的重要方向。

区块链平台开发的挑战

尽管区块链平台的开发潜力巨大,但面临的挑战也不容小觑。首先是技术复杂性,区块链涉及多种技术,如分布式网络、加密算法、智能合约等,开发者需要具备丰富的技术背景才能高效开发。其次是法律与监管问题,区块链的去中心化特性与传统法律体系存在矛盾,各国在法律上对区块链技术的态度也不尽相同,如何在合规的框架内进行创新将是一个重要课题。此外,区块链网络的扩展性与安全性同样需要关注,如何在保证安全性的前提下提升网络的处理能力是需要克服的技术瓶颈。

区块链平台的应用前景

随着区块链技术的不断成熟,未来的应用前景令人瞩目。在金融服务领域,区块链可以用于跨境支付、资产证券化等,降低中介成本,提高交易效率。在供应链管理中,区块链可以实现商品从生产到销售的全程可追溯,提升供应链的透明度。而在医疗健康领域,区块链可以安全高效地管理患者数据,提高医疗服务的质量和效率,确保疾病预防和治疗数据的安全性。此外,数字身份认证、版权保护等领域也是区块链技术有潜力应用的方向。

可能相关问题探讨

如何选择合适的区块链平台进行开发?

在开发区块链应用时,选择合适的平台是非常重要的一步。不同的区块链平台各自具有其特色和适用场景,因此开发者需要根据项目的需求进行选择。首先考虑的是性能与可扩展性。有的平台如Ethereum(以太坊)提供了丰富的智能合约功能,但在大型交易中可能面临性能瓶颈;而Hyperledger则更适合企业级应用,能够提供更高的性能和权限管理。在确定平台后,也要关注其开发社区的活跃度与支持情况,优秀的社区可以为开发提供丰富的资源与帮助。此外,安全性也是选择平台时必须重点考虑的因素,开发者应评估平台已知的安全漏洞与修复速度,以确保应用的安全性稳定性。

区块链技术如何影响传统行业?

区块链技术对传统行业的影响深远,尤其是在金融、物流、医疗等领域。相比传统模式,区块链能够提高数据处理的透明度与安全性,重新定义交易及信息的流转方式。例如在金融领域,区块链能够实现快速且低成本的跨境支付,突破传统银行的时间和费用限制。在物流领域,基于区块链的供应链管理可以实现实时追踪,确保商品信息的真实性,减少流程中的中介环节,从而降低成本。此外,在医疗行业,利用区块链技术可以更安全地管理患者信息,实现信息的共享与保密,确保数据在多个医疗机构间流通的安全性。随着越来越多的行业认识到区块链的价值,传统行业的转型已经在悄然发生。

智能合约在区块链平台中的应用如何?

智能合约是区块链技术中一项颇具创新的功能,它将合约的条款与自动执行的代码结合在一起,极大地提高了交易的效率。智能合约的应用场景非常广泛,从金融衍生品交易到保险索赔,从产权转移到众筹融资,几乎可以涵盖所有需要合同执行的领域。智能合约能够消除中介的需求,减少交易的成本,提高即刻性和透明性,同时为所有交易各方提供了可追溯性。然而,智能合约的设计与执行需要极高的技术规范,因为一旦合约代码被部署,就不能随意修改。因此,在开发智能合约时,开发者需严格审查代码,确保其能够准确反映合约条款,有效规避潜在的安全风险。

区块链平台的安全性如何保障?

保障区块链平台的安全性是开发与运营过程中至关重要的环节之一。区块链的安全性主要体现在其去中心化、数据不可篡改等特点,但是仍然面临不少安全挑战。首先,随着区块链应用的普及,越来越多的黑客将目光瞄准了这一领域。如何防御51%攻击、重放攻击以及智能合约漏洞都是开发者需重点关注的问题。此外,私钥的管理也是关键一环,用户私钥的泄露可能导致数字资产的损失,因此需要强有力的加密与备份措施。针对区块链网络的安全防护,还需定期进行渗透测试与安全审计,以发现潜在的漏洞并及时修复,从而构建一条更为安全、可靠的区块链生态系统。

区块链技术的未来发展趋势是什么?

未来区块链技术的发展将集中在多个方面。首先是跨链技术的应用愈发广泛,通过实现不同区块链间的互联互通,能够实现资源的配置与数据的高效流转。此外,零知识证明等隐私保护技术的进步将为区块链的普及带来新的契机,满足更多用户对隐私的需求。其次,随着政府及机构对区块链技术的关注,加固的监管环境将促使区块链行业的成熟。最后,随着人工智能与区块链的结合,未来可能会出现更为智能化的区块链应用,推动更多商业模式的创新。在这一过程中,技术开发者需紧跟趋势,灵活应对变化,才能在数字经济的浪潮中占据优势。

结语

区块链平台技术的开发正逐步成为数字经济的重要组成部分。随着技术的不断演进,未来区块链将在更多行业中发挥革命性的作用。开发者在技术、业务和安全等多方面的深入探索,将是推动这一领域进步的根本动力。希望通过本文能够引发大家对区块链技术开发的深入思考,并促进在实际应用中的创新和实践。

以上是关于区块链平台技术开发的详细介绍以及潜在的相关问题及其解析。区块链的未来充满挑战与机遇,愿更多的人参与到这场技术革命中来,共同推动数字经济的向前发展。